WEB, an acronym for Where Everybody Belongs, is a middle school transition program that welcomes 6th graders and makes them feel comfortable throughout the first year of their middle school experience. Members of the 8th grade class are trained to act as positive role models, motivators,leaders and teachers who guide the 6th graders to discover what it takes to be successful in middle school. Schools have reported that WEB has helped reduce bullying and discipline issues, as well as increased student safety and connection for the whole school.
